Registered Nurse (MCH-Outreach)

POSITION DESCRIPTION

Under general supervision, this position provides public health nursing services to pregnant and postpartum women, infants, toddlers, and their families in homes and community settings.
Performs other duties as required. This position is supervised by the Maternal Child Health
Outreach Services Team Leader.

WORK PERFORMED

50% Nursing Process. Performs health, development and nutrition assessments on pregnant women, infants, toddlers, and postpartum women. Assesses clients’ needs based on gathering of information, histories and screening tests. Provides education, information, support and guidance to families and makes appropriate referrals based on findings.
Focuses on early intervention, health/nutrition education, breastfeeding education/support and anticipatory guidance for families. Work is centered around obtaining positive outcomes by improving the health of pregnant women and babies through reducing the prevalence of birth defects, premature birth and infant mortality. Teach group education classes to pregnant women and their support person.

30% Documentation. Maintains timely, complete and accurate documentation in the family health record including documentation of referrals and reports to other care providers in order to assure the health of families served. Complete chart abstractions.

10% Quality Assurance/Team Process. Participates in all necessary training to ensure understanding of and adherence to MCH guidelines. Participates on various inter-
Department and intra-Department teams to assure continuity and consistency in service delivery as defined by protocols, procedures, grants and program standards.

10% Program Responsibilities. Adheres to nursing standards of practice and follows

Department procedures and protocols as well as local, State and Federal regulations.
Will travel to client homes, various community sites and satellite clinic locations as needed to deliver services. Completes accurate program time studies and travel reports.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

License to practice as a Registered Nurse in the State of Kansas.

CPR Certification.

Has a working car.

Valid Driver’s License and able to operate County-owned vehicle (HR-2013-2).

HR-2013-2: Driving record that shows: No misdemeanor or felony convictions for traffic/vehicular offenses (DUI, vehicular homicide, reckless driving, hit and run, etc.) on the driving record that are less than five (5) years old; No more than two (2) at fault or chargeable accidents on their driving record that are less than five (5) years old; No more than two (2) traffic infractions (speeding, failure to yield right of way, etc.) that are less than one (1) year old.

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S

Required to pass a pre-employment physical and drug screen.

Required to lift up to thirty (30) pounds.

If CPR Certification has lapsed, will be required to renew their Certification within 120 days of employment.
